public PreparedStatement setNull(final int index) { return set(index, Value.NULL); }
@Override public final PostgresPreparedStatement set(final int index, final Value<?> param) { return create(super.set(index, param)); } }
public PreparedStatement setLong(final int index, final Long value) { return set(index, value == null ? Value.NULL : new LongValue(value)); }
public PreparedStatement setLocalDateTime(final int index, final LocalDateTime value) { return set(index, value == null ? Value.NULL : new LocalDateTimeValue(value)); }
public PreparedStatement setUUID(final int index, final UUID value) { return set(index, value == null ? Value.NULL : new UUIDValue(value)); }
public PreparedStatement setBoolean(final int index, final Boolean value) { return set(index, value == null ? Value.NULL : new BooleanValue(value)); }
public PreparedStatement setDouble(final int index, final Double value) { return set(index, value == null ? Value.NULL : new DoubleValue(value)); }
public PreparedStatement setFloat(final int index, final Float value) { return set(index, value == null ? Value.NULL : new FloatValue(value)); }
public PreparedStatement setByteArray(final int index, final byte[] value) { return set(index, value == null ? Value.NULL : new ByteArrayValue(value)); }
public PreparedStatement setInteger(final int index, final Integer value) { return set(index, value == null ? Value.NULL : new IntegerValue(value)); }
public PreparedStatement setLocalTime(final int index, final LocalTime value) { return set(index, value == null ? Value.NULL : new LocalTimeValue(value)); }
public PreparedStatement setString(final int index, final String value) { return set(index, value == null ? Value.NULL : new StringValue(value)); }
public PreparedStatement setBigDecimal(final int index, final BigDecimal value) { return set(index, value == null ? Value.NULL : new BigDecimalValue(value)); }
public PreparedStatement setLocalDate(final int index, final LocalDate value) { return set(index, value == null ? Value.NULL : new LocalDateValue(value)); }
public PreparedStatement setByte(final int index, final Byte value) { return set(index, value == null ? Value.NULL : new ByteValue(value)); }
public PreparedStatement setShort(final int index, final Short value) { return set(index, value == null ? Value.NULL : new ShortValue(value)); }
public PreparedStatement set(final Value<?> param) { return set(nextIndex(), param); }